 |  The 
			First Time a band has played on the balcony over the entrance to 
			the Nottingham Council House.  They were there to-day ---an 
			American Army band, who paid their respects to the Lord Mayor. - 
			newspaper and date unknown. (courtesy of Nico Jongeneel)
 |  Lord 
			Mayor F. Mitchell presents a memento to the 508th, perhaps to bandmaster CWO 
			Oliver Margolin. Domenic Valente may be 1st row, 5th from left. All 
			others unidentified. (9courtsy of Nico 
			Jongeneel).
 |  112th 
			Army Ground Forces Band in Frankfurt, 1945 was the result of merging the 508th Band 
			along with other existing groups.
 Angelo Greco, first enlisted rank, 3rd from 
			left.  All others unidentified
